ALEXANDRIA, Va., Dec. 9 -- United States Patent no. 12,492,677, issued on Dec. 9, was assigned to INTERNATIONAL BUSINESS MACHINES Corp. (Armonk, N.Y.).

"Energy generation controller for wind turbine with shadow-effect energy generator(s)" was invented by Sarbajit Kumar Rakshit (Kolkata, India), Jagabondhu Hazra (Bangalore, India) and Manikandan Padmanaban (Chennai, India).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"An energy generation control process is provided for a wind turbine with shadow-effect energy generator(s).
